Solution for -5x+3=-57 equation:


Simplifying
-5x + 3 = -57

Reorder the terms:
3 + -5x = -57

Solving
3 + -5x = -57

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-3' to each side of the equation.
3 + -3 + -5x = -57 + -3

Combine like terms: 3 + -3 = 0
0 + -5x = -57 + -3
-5x = -57 + -3

Combine like terms: -57 + -3 = -60
-5x = -60

Divide each side by '-5'.
x = 12
